在Ubuntu系统中,MySQL的错误日志通常位于/var/log/mysql/error.log
。要排查MySQL错误日志,请按照以下步骤操作:
打开终端(Terminal)。
使用文本编辑器打开错误日志文件。这里我们使用nano
编辑器,你也可以使用其他编辑器,如vim
或gedit
。输入以下命令:
sudo nano /var/log/mysql/error.log
如果系统提示输入密码,请输入你的用户密码。
查看错误日志。在nano
编辑器中,你可以使用上下箭头键或Page Up/Page Down键来滚动查看日志内容。仔细阅读日志,查找与错误相关的信息。错误日志中可能包含错误代码、错误描述以及发生错误的SQL语句等。
分析错误原因。根据日志中的错误信息,尝试找出导致错误的原因。常见的MySQL错误包括连接失败、权限问题、表损坏等。
解决问题。根据分析出的错误原因,采取相应的措施解决问题。例如,如果是连接失败,检查数据库服务器是否正在运行;如果是权限问题,检查用户权限设置;如果是表损坏,尝试修复或恢复损坏的表。
保存并退出编辑器。在nano
编辑器中,按Ctrl + X
键,然后按Y
键确认保存更改,最后按Enter
键退出编辑器。
重启MySQL服务。在解决问题后,建议重启MySQL服务以确保更改生效。在终端中输入以下命令:
sudo systemctl restart mysql
验证问题是否解决。重新尝试导致错误的操作,检查问题是否已经解决。
如果你在排查过程中遇到困难,可以提供具体的错误信息,以便进一步分析和解决问题。